Shares set new records almost every other day. The PX index put on 5.5 percent to 1,806.3 points in April.

There were only few bad news in April and companies announced improved economic results, dividend payment and foreign acquisitions.

Buying mood was boosted by favourable investment recommendations and growth on leading share markets to new records.

Phone operator Telefonica O2 jumped by 13 percent to Kc619.4. Telefonica shareholders approved a growth in dividends by Kc5 to Kc50 per share in April.

Telefonica also announced an increase in first-quarter profit by 12.5 percent to Kc2.3bn, exceeding market expectations.

The driver had a permit for plastic waste transport but was carrying municipal waste, Bartak said.

The customs officers uncovered the illegal consignment with the aid of a giant X-ray equipment. The lorry has been laid up and the customs officers and environmental inspectors are investigating the case.

Several cases of illegal import or dumping of waste from Germany have been reported in the Czech Republic in the past months.

An illegal dump of tens of tonnes of German waste was uncovered in Studanky near As, west Bohemia, which is now being removed.

In 2006 Czech customs officers registered 256 cases of suspected violation of waste transport.

There are currently 22 centres around the world where visitors can learnabout the Czech Republic’s history, economy, and culture. These CzechCentres are funded by the Foreign Ministry with a mission to fosterdialogue with the public abroad and promote the country as a modern anddynamic state. The centres meet their goal with the help of variousprojects, ranging from literature readings to theatre performances. Czech President Vaclav Klaus ended a four-day trip to the RussianFederation on Sunday - the first ever official visit to Russia by a Czechhead of state. Accompanied by an unusually large delegation ofbusinessmen, Mr Klaus’s chief aim was, he said, to boost bilateralrelations, with special emphasis on economy. However, the meeting betweenPresident Klaus and Russian President Vladmir Putin was to a large extentdominated by the US project to install a tracking radar in the CzechRepublic. Svatopluk Benes, one of the country’s leading actors in the interwar yearsof the First Republic, has died at the age of 89. He was one of the lastremaining legends of the silver screen in the brief time when Czechcinematography enjoyed a period of Hollywood glamour. Knoetig said that this means that Minarik’s case has definitively ended after more than 15 years. The decision was made last week at a closed meeting.

Minarik was acquitted of charges of an attempted bomb attack in the seat of the U.S.-funded Radio Free Europe in Munich, Germany, in the 1970s. He worked for the radio from 1969 to 1976 as an StB agent.

Vesecka wanted that the investigation of Minarik’s case return to the preparatory proceedings. She said that new witnesses should be heard by the Office for the Investigation and Documentation of Communist Crimes (UDV).

The Supreme Court rejected Vesecka’s review on formal grounds. The arguments for the decision have not been released so far.
